La Rumba Buena is super excited to welcome NYC native and world-renowned DJ Bobbito Garcia a.k.a. Kool Bob Love!
Whether you know him from his legendary radio show with Stretch Armstrong, his column in VIBE magazine, or his award-winning documentaries — he is a man of many talents.
His love for Latin music started at a young age. His father was a Latin jazz musician who once opened up for Tito Puente, while his mother was the hairdresser for Fania All Star singer Pete "El Conde" Rodriguez. Steeped in the culture, Bobbito went on to co-found the world's first officially endorsed Fania Records DJ tribute event in 2008, and has spun for the label multiple times since. He’s also opened up for The Spanish Harlem Orchestra, Los Van Van, Tato Torres y Yerba Buena, and a Rumba Buena favourite — Eddie Palmieri.

La Rumba Buena is a night dedicated to classic Latin sounds inspired by the salsatecas in Cali, Havana, and New York. No frills, pure vibes, and a non-stop dance floor open to anyone who catches the rhythm.
La Rumba Buena just means a great party and ‘Rumber@s’ are people who love to dance. Expect to hear Salsa, Boogaloo, Cumbia, Guaguanco, Son, Rumba, Descargas, Mambo, Cha-Cha-Cha, Bomba, and Plena from the resident DJs. With a stack of vinyl collected over a decade from across the Americas, DJs Blancon and Drumspeak play out the sounds from the Latin Diaspora and bring La Rumba Buena to Toronto.
